Deuteron Disintegration by Electrons

Abstract
The cross section for the disintegration of deuterons by electrons has been calculated. Near the threshold the "magnetic" cross section is larger, increasing with the square while the "electric" cross section increases with the cube of the energy. They become equal at about 600 kev above the threshold when each has a value of 3.5×1031 cm2. The disintegration neutrons should be observable from 50 kev up. An experiment of this kind might therefore be used to check the theoretically predicted magnetic disintegration. This seems desirable since a parallel effect for photo-disintegration has so far not been observed.
